The Glory and Diversity of Indian Festivals

Indian festivals are an essential part of the country's rich cultural heritage, with each festival carrying deep religious, historical, and social significance. India is known for its diversity, and this is reflected in the multitude of festivals celebrated across the country, ranging from national holidays to regional events. This book offers a beautiful visual journey through the many festivals celebrated in India. It highlights the significance, history, and cultural aspects of festivals like Diwali, Holi, and more. This book covers religious, seasonal, and regional celebrations, explaining their symbolism, customs, and importance in Indian society.
